
Vyatta is a Debian based router firewall , better than cisco and Juniper, Dave Roberts, and Kelly Herrell executives at Vyatta., to get the lates distribution you can go to http://www.vyatta.com/
enjoy it ![]()
The Power to Serve!

Vyatta is a Debian based router firewall , better than cisco and Juniper, Dave Roberts, and Kelly Herrell executives at Vyatta., to get the lates distribution you can go to http://www.vyatta.com/
enjoy it ![]()
Create IPtables and PF rules in a graphical mode,
with http://www.fwbuilder.org/ ![]()
Paquet à installer : # apt-get install apache2
Pour valider qu’Apache fonctionne correctement, il faut saisir l’adresse suivante dans un navigateur :
http://localhost
La commande suivante permet de démarrer, d’arrêter, de redémarrer ou de recharger le serveur :
# /etc/init.d/apache2 start (ou stop ou restart ou reload)
Installation de MySQL 4
Paquet à installer :
apt-get install mysql-server
La commande suivante permet de démarrer, d’arrêter, de redémarrer ou de recharger le serveur :
# /etc/init.d/mysql start (ou stop ou restart ou reload)
Si aucun mot de passe n’a encore été défini pour MySQL, la commande suivante sous root permet d’entrer dans le mode ligne de commande de MySQL pour valider que tout fonctionne :
# mysql
Saisir « quit » pour sortir du mode de commande de MySQL.
Si un mot de passe a été défini pour l’utilisateur « root » de MySQL, la commande suivante permet de se connecter à MySQL depuis n’importe quel utilisateur Linux :
$ mysql -u root -p
Installation de PHP
Paquets à installer pour PHP avec le support de MySQL, la possibilité de créer des scripts php (/usr/bin/php) et la libraire pour faire fonctionner apache2 avec php4 :
apt-get install php4 php4-mysql php4-cli libapache2-mod-php4
Après avoir installé PHP, vous pouvez redémarrer apache, mais normalement ce n’est pas nécessaire :
/etc/init.d/apache2 restart
Pour vérifier que PHP fonctionne correctement avec apache, il faut créer par exemple le fichier « test.php » dans « /var/www » contenant la commande suivante :
< ? phpinfo(); ?>
Et ensuite depuis un navigateur, il faut saisir l’adresse suivante :
http://localhost/test.php
Activer le module MySQL dans PHP
Par défaut, Le module MySQL n’est pas activé dans PHP. Par exemple, si vous utilisez la fonction « mysql_connect », vous aurez le message d’erreur suivant :
Fatal error : Call to undefined function
Pour activer ce module, il faut décommenter la ligne « extension=mysql.so » du fichier « /etc/php4/apache2/php.ini »
Et redémarrer apache :
# /etc/init.d/apache2 restart
Installation de phpmyadmin
Paquet à installer :
apt-get install phpmyadmin
Pour vérifier que « phpmyadmin » fonctionne, il faut saisir l’adresse suivante dans un navigateur :
http://localhost/phpmyadmin
Une fenêtre de connexion à MySQL doit apparaître et si aucun mot de passe n’a encore été défini dans MySQL, il faut mettre « root » en nom d’utilisateur et ne rien mettre en mot de passe.
Après cette installation, je vous conseille vivement de mettre un mot de passe à l’utilisateur « root » de MySQL en cliquant sur le lien « Modifier le mot de passe ».